How much do spa j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average hourly pay for spa in Wisconsin is $14.71,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.12 and $16.25 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a spa man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Spa Manager, you need expertise in hospitality management, business operations, and a relevant qualification such as a degree or certification in spa or wellness management. Familiarity with spa booking systems, inventory management software, and health and safety regulations is typically required. Outstanding customer service, leadership, and problem-solving abilities help create a welcoming environment and motivate staff. These competencies are crucial for ensuring smooth operations, client satisfaction, and business growth in a competitive wellness industry.

What are some of the most common challenges faced by spa professionals, and how can they be managed on the job?

Spa professionals often encounter challenges such as managing a busy client schedule, maintaining high standards of hygiene, and ensuring consistent customer satisfaction. Adapting to each client's unique needs while staying on time requires strong organizational and communication skills. Collaborating closely with colleagues, such as receptionists and other therapists, can help create a seamless guest experience. Ongoing professional development and self-care are important to prevent burnout and maintain a positive work environment.

Are spa jobs stressful?

Spa jobs can be stressful due to high customer expectations, physical demands, and managing multiple clients simultaneously. Employees often need strong communication skills and the ability to handle emotional or difficult situations, which can contribute to job stress.

What degree do you need to work at a spa?

To work at a spa, most positions such as estheticians, massage therapists, or skincare specialists require a relevant state license and a high school diploma or equivalent. Some roles may also require specialized training or certification in areas like massage therapy or skincare treatments.

What jobs can you do in a spa?

Jobs in a spa include roles such as massage therapists, estheticians, skincare specialists, receptionists, and spa managers. These positions often require relevant certifications, good customer service skills, and knowledge of spa treatments and products.

What qualifications do I need to work in a spa?

To work in a spa, most positions require relevant certifications such as esthetician, massage therapist, or cosmetologist licenses, which typically involve completing a state-approved training program and passing licensing exams. Additionally, strong customer service skills, cleanliness, and knowledge of spa treatments are important for success in the role.

Job description

Location: Kohler, WI

Opportunity

ย Join our world-class team of spa professionals and help our guests renew and recharge while they experience five-star living at its finest.ย 

S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Supporting the cleanliness and maintenance of the Kohler Waters Spa facility and equipment
  • Attending to the Reception Desk located in the lower level to accommodate client check-in for sandals, robes and lockers
  • Gathering used linens from treatment rooms and assemble for pick-up by The American
  • Club laundry staff; distribute clean linens to designated storage areas and/or treatment rooms
  • Maintaining neatness and order around the Spa Relaxation Pool lounge area
  • Assisting Group Coordinator with setup tasks involving special group requirements
  • Consistently maintaining cleanliness of desk, reception area, retail centers, and flooring
  • Being responsible for knowing and performing proper opening/closing procedures
  • Assisting spa technicians with locating guests, giving messages or communicating guest's needs
  • Maintaining a high level of customer service for all spa guests

This is a part time position, working weekdays & weekends. Shifts vary between 6:15 am - 9:30 pm.
